BODY { PADDING-RIGHT: 0px; MARGIN-TOP: 0px; PADDING-LEFT: 0px; FONT-SIZE: 10px; PADDING-BOTTOM: 0px; COLOR: Black; PADDING-TOP: 0px; FONT-FAMILY: verdana, Arial, Helvetica, sans-serif; } /***** TRAIT *********/ hr.spip{ margin-bottom: 5px; color: #F3EDBB; border-color: #F3EDBB; border-width : 1px 0px 0px 0px; height: 1pt; } /***** INTERTITRES *********/ h3.spip { margin-top : 30px; margin-bottom : 30px; font-family: Verdana,Arial,Sans,sans-serif; font-weight: bold; font-size: 110%; text-align: left; COLOR:#F3EDBB; } .jaune { color: #F4ECBC } .bleu { color: #4389A9 } .rouge { color: #EE1C00 } TD { FONT-SIZE: 8pt; COLOR:#FFFFFF; FONT-FAMILY: verdana, Arial, Helvetica, sans-serif; } .td_noir{ FONT-SIZE: 9pt; COLOR:#000000; FONT-FAMILY: verdana, Arial, Helvetica, sans-serif; } .td_brown{ FONT-SIZE: 8pt; COLOR:#800808; FONT-FAMILY: verdana, Arial, Helvetica, sans-serif; } .td_titre{ FONT-SIZE: 7pt; COLOR:#FFFFFF; FONT-FAMILY: verdana, Arial, Helvetica, sans-serif; } .td_jaune{ FONT-SIZE: 8pt; COLOR:#F0BA00; FONT-FAMILY: verdana, Arial, Helvetica, sans-serif; } /********* jaune : F0BA00***********/ a:link { color: #F0BA00; text-decoration: none } a:visited { color: #F0BA00; text-decoration: none } a:hover { color: #B7B7B7; text-decoration: none } a:active { color: #F0BA00; text-decoration: none } a:visited:hover { color: #B7B7B7; text-decoration: none } a.orange:link { color: #DA9914; text-decoration: none } a.orange:active { color: #DA9914; text-decoration: underline } a.orange:hover { color: #DA9914; text-decoration: underline } a.orange:visited { color: #DA9914; text-decoration: none } a.orange:visited:hover { color: #DA9914; text-decoration: underline } a.noir:link { color: #000000; text-decoration: underline } a.noir:active { color: #000000; text-decoration: underline } a.noir:hover { color: #000000; text-decoration: underline } a.noir:visited { color: #000000; text-decoration: underline } a.noir:visited:hover { color: #000000; text-decoration: underline } a.noir2:link { color: #000000; text-decoration: none } a.noir2:active { color: #000000; text-decoration: none } a.noir2:hover { color: #000000; text-decoration: none } a.noir2:visited { color: #000000; text-decoration: none } a.noir2:visited:hover { color: #000000; text-decoration: none } a.gris:link { color: #666666; text-decoration: none } a.gris:active { color: #666666; text-decoration: underline } a.gris:hover { color: #666666; text-decoration: underline } a.gris:visited { color: #666666; text-decoration: none } a.gris:visited:hover { color: #666666; text-decoration: underline } a.agenda:link { color: #485670; text-decoration: none; FONT-SIZE: 9pt } a.agenda:active { color: #485670; text-decoration: none; FONT-SIZE: 9pt } a.agenda:hover { color: #FFFFFF; text-decoration: none; FONT-SIZE: 9pt } a.agenda:visited { color: #485670; text-decoration: none; FONT-SIZE: 9pt } a.agenda:visited:hover { color: #FFFFFF; text-decoration: none; FONT-SIZE: 9pt } .nav_agenda { color: #FFFFFF; FONT-SIZE: 9pt } /* * Barre de raccourcis */ a.barre img { padding: 4px; margin: 1px; border: 1px solid #aaaaaa; background-color: #e4e4e4; -moz-border-radius: 5px; } a.barre:hover img { padding: 4px; margin: 1px; border: 1px solid #999999; background-color: white; -moz-border-radius: 5px; } .t { FONT-WEIGHT: bold; FONT-SIZE: 8pt; } .r { FONT-SIZE: 6pt; COLOR: Black; } .b { FONT-WEIGHT: bold; FONT-SIZE: 6pt; COLOR: Black; LETTER-SPACING: 0pt } .item { font-size: 7pt; background: #FFFFFF; font-family:verdana; border : 1px solid ; } /* * Cadre blanc arrondi */ .cadre { padding: 0px; margin: 0px; border: 0px; width: 100%; } /* Haut-gauche, etc. */ .r-hg { width: 5px; height: 24px; background: url('img_pack/rond-hg-24.gif') no-repeat right bottom; } .r-h { height: 24px; background: url('img_pack/rond-h-24.gif') repeat-x bottom; text-align: ; } .r-hd { width: 5px; height: 24px; background: url('img_pack/rond-hd-24.gif') no-repeat left bottom; } .r-g { width: 5px; background: url('img_pack/rond-g.gif') repeat-y right; } .r-d { width: 5px; background: url('img_pack/rond-d.gif') repeat-y left; } .r-bg { width: 5px; height: 5px; background: url('img_pack/rond-bg.gif') no-repeat right top; } .r-b { height: 5px; background: url('img_pack/rond-b.gif') repeat-x top; } .r-bd { width: 5px; height: 5px; background: url('img_pack/rond-bd.gif') no-repeat left top; } .r-c { background: white; padding: 2px; text-align: ; } /* * Cadre gris enfonce */ /* Haut-gauche, etc. */ .e-hg { width: 5px; height: 24px; background: url('img_pack/cadre-hg.gif') no-repeat right bottom; } .e-h { height: 24px; background: url('img_pack/cadre-h.gif') repeat-x bottom; text-align: ; } .e-hd { width: 5px; height: 24px; background: url('img_pack/cadre-hd.gif') no-repeat left bottom; } .e-g { width: 5px; background: url('img_pack/cadre-g.gif') repeat-y right; } .e-d { width: 5px; background: url('img_pack/cadre-d.gif') repeat-y left; } .e-bg { width: 5px; height: 5px; background: url('img_pack/cadre-bg.gif') no-repeat right top; } .e-b { height: 5px; background: url('img_pack/cadre-b.gif') repeat-x top; } .e-bd { width: 5px; height: 5px; background: url('img_pack/cadre-bd.gif') no-repeat left top; } .e-c { background: #e0e0e0; padding: 2px; text-align: ; } table.spip { } table.spip tr.row_first { background-color: #FCF4D0; COLOR: Black; } table.spip tr.row_odd { background-color: #1D9060; COLOR: Black; } table.spip tr.row_even { background-color: #058555; COLOR: #FFFFFF; } table.spip td { padding: 3px; text-align: left; vertical-align: center; COLOR: Black; } /* calendar styles */ #calendar_div { display: none; border: 1px solid #777; z-index: 10; font-family: Arial, Helvetica, sans-serif; font-size: 16px; } #calendar_div a { cursor: pointer; cursor: hand; } button.calendar_trigger { width: 25px; } img.calendar_trigger { margin: 2px; vertical-align: middle; } #calendar_control, #calendar_links, #calendar_header, #calendar { clear: both; float: left; width: 185px; color: #fff; } #calendar_control { background: #01603A; } #calendar_links { background: #068753; } #calendar_control a, #calendar_links a { font-weight: bold; font-size: 75%; letter-spacing: 1px; padding: 2px 5px; color: #eee; } #calendar_control a:hover { background: #fdd; color: #333; } #calendar_links a:hover { background: #ddd; color: #333; } #calendar_clear, #calendar_prev { float: left; } #calendar_current { float: left; width: 35%; text-align: center; } #calendar_close, #calendar_next { float: right; } #calendar_header { background: #01603A; text-align: center; } #calendar_header select { background: #01603A; color: #fff; border: 0px; font-weight: bold; } #calendar { background: #ccc; text-align: center; font-size: 105%; } #calendar a { color: #333; } #calendar a:hover { color: #000; background: none; } #calendar .calendar_titleRow { background: #777; } #calendar .calendar_daysRow { background: #eee; color: #666; } #calendar .calendar_daysCell { color: #000; border: 1px solid #ddd; } #calendar .calendar_weekEndCell { background: #ddd; } #calendar .calendar_daysCellOver { background: #fff; border: 1px solid #777; } #calendar .calendar_unselectable { color: #888; } #calendar_today { background: #fcc !important; } #calendar_currentDay { background: #999 !important; } #calendar_cover { display: none; /*sorry for IE5*/ display/**/: block; /*sorry for IE5*/ position: absolute; /*must have*/ z-index: -1; /*must have*/ filter: mask(); /*must have*/ top: -1; /*must have*/ left: -1px; /*must have*/ width: 187px; /*must have to match width and borders*/ height: 210px; /*must have to match maximum height*/ }